Lipedema is a chronic medical condition that causes an abnormal buildup of fat, usually in the legs, hips, buttocks, and sometimes the arms. It primarily affects women and is often misunderstood or mistaken for obesity or lymphedema.
Lipedema is not simply excess body weight; it is a disorder involving fat tissue that can lead to pain, swelling, bruising, and mobility difficulties. The condition typically progresses over time if left untreated, making early diagnosis and proper management extremely important.
